Factors to Consider When Choosing a CPU for Project Management Software

When choosing a CPU for project management software, there are several key factors to consider:

Clock Speed

The clock speed of a CPU refers to the number of cycles it can perform per second. A higher clock speed means that the CPU can process more data in less time, resulting in faster performance. However, higher clock speeds also generate more heat, which can affect the lifespan of the CPU.

Number of Cores

The number of cores in a CPU refers to the number of processing units it has. A CPU with more cores can perform multiple tasks simultaneously, resulting in faster and more efficient performance. However, not all software is optimized for multi-core CPUs, so it’s important to choose a CPU that is suitable for your specific project management software.

Cache Size

The cache size of a CPU refers to the amount of memory it has for storing frequently used data. A larger cache size can help to reduce the time it takes to access this data, resulting in faster performance.
